The arrangement and function of keys can vary, but a standard QWERTY keyboard typically boasts around 104 keys. This number, however, is not absolute and can fluctuate based on regional layouts, the inclusion of multimedia controls, or specialized gaming features. | Category | Details |
|—|—|
| **Alphanumeric Keys** | Standard letters (A-Z) and numbers (0-9). |
| **Modifier Keys** | Shift, Ctrl, Alt, Win/Command keys. These keys modify the function of other keys when pressed simultaneously. |
| **Navigation Keys** | Arrow keys (Up, Down, Left, Right), Home, End, Page Up, Page Down. Used for moving the cursor and navigating documents. |
| **Function Keys** | F1 through F12. Their functions vary depending on the active application. |
| **Punctuation and Symbol Keys** | Keys for common punctuation marks (!, @, #, $, %, ^, &, *, (, ), -, =, [, ], ;, ‘, ,, ., /, {, }, :, “, <, >, ?, ~). |
| **Control Keys** | Enter, Backspace, Delete, Tab, Caps Lock, Num Lock, Scroll Lock, Pause/Break. |
| **Numeric Keypad** | Dedicated section for numerical input and arithmetic operations (typically on full-sized keyboards). |
| **Special/Multimedia Keys** | Volume controls, play/pause, mute, track skipping, power buttons, sleep, etc. (often found on multimedia or gaming keyboards). |

## The Evolution of the Keyboard: From Typewriters to Touchscreens
The journey of the keyboard is a fascinating narrative of innovation. Early typewriters, the predecessors to computer keyboards, established the QWERTY layout, a design chosen to prevent mechanical jamming rather than for optimal typing speed. As computers emerged, the typewriter keyboard was adapted, with the addition of keys never before seen, such as Control, Alt, and Function keys. This evolution continued with the integration of dedicated keys for specific operating system functions and, on many modern keyboards, multimedia controls that allow users to manage audio and video playback without interrupting their workflow.
### Function Keys: The Versatile Powerhouses
The Function keys (F1-F12) represent a unique category of keys, offering context-sensitive commands that can significantly enhance productivity. Their primary role is to provide shortcuts for common or complex operations within different software applications. For instance, F1 is almost universally used to summon help documentation, while F5 often triggers a refresh action in web browsers and file explorers.

### Multimedia and Hotkeys: Convenience Redefined
Many contemporary keyboards integrate dedicated multimedia keys, offering direct control over volume, playback, and other media functions. These hotkeys, often placed along the top or side of the keyboard, provide instant access to commands that would otherwise require navigating through menus or using complex key combinations.
Some keyboards include a “Scroll Lock” key. Historically, it toggled the behavior of the arrow keys to scroll the entire document rather than just the cursor. In modern applications, its function is rarely used, though it persists for compatibility reasons.

## FAQ: Your Keyboard Questions Answered
* **Q: How many keys are on a typical US keyboard?**
* A: A standard US keyboard typically has 104 keys.
* **Q: What is the purpose of the Function keys (F1-F12)?**
* A: Function keys provide context-sensitive shortcuts for various commands within software applications.
* **Q: Are there different keyboard layouts?**
* A: Yes, common layouts include QWERTY, AZERTY (French), and QWERTZ (German), among others, differing in the arrangement of letters and symbols.
* **Q: What are modifier keys?**
* A: Modifier keys like Shift, Ctrl, and Alt alter the function of other keys when pressed in combination with them.
* **Q: What is an ergonomic keyboard?**
* A: An ergonomic keyboard is designed to minimize physical strain and discomfort during prolonged use, often featuring split or curved designs.
